Choose the CFMoto 250 Dual-EFI if
CFMoto 250 Dual-EFI costs रु 25,100 less ex-showroom.250 Dual-EFI has 1.7 PS more power.

At Rs 549,900, this looks strong value if you want a light dual-sport with real ground clearance. It suits riders prioritizing rough-road ability over premium electronics and touring comfort.

Pros
Light 154 kg kerb weight helps city handling.
245 mm ground clearance is class-leading for rough roads.
Dual-channel ABS and slipper clutch add confidence.
Six-speed EFI drivetrain is practical and efficient.
Cons
Single variant limits choice and equipment flexibility.
LCD dash feels basic at this price.
No documented Bluetooth or riding modes.
Tall seat can deter shorter riders.

Choose the Morbidelli T250X if
You prefer its body style, brand or dealer near you — the numbers are close.

At around NPR 5.75 lakh ex-showroom, the T250X offers a rare 250 cc adventure-style bike with proper dual-purpose hardware, making it attractive for riders upgrading from 150–200 cc commuters who want light touring and gravel-road capability. However, the mixed price reports and limited early dealership footprint mean buyers should confirm the latest official price and support before purchase; overall, it suits enthusiasts seeking an affordable adventure-styled motorcycle more than pure value-focused commuters.

Pros
Strong 249 cc engine with 22.4 hp and 22.3 Nm giving better performance than typical 150–200 cc rivals.
High 220 mm ground clearance and long-travel suspension make it genuinely suitable for rough Nepali roads and light trails.
Dual-channel ABS and front–rear disc brakes are good safety equipment in this price bracket.
Adventure-focused ergonomics with upright posture and wide handlebars improve comfort on longer rides.
Cons
Only a single variant and color limit choice compared with established Japanese and Indian rivals.
Brand and service network are still new and relatively limited in Nepal, which may worry long-term owners.
Fuel efficiency around 20–25 km/l is modest for cost-conscious riders versus smaller-capacity commuters.
Several important details like instrument cluster features and underseat storage are not clearly specified for Nepal.

Our verdict

On our data the CFMoto 250 Dual-EFI is the stronger buy: it is रु 25,100 cheaper ex-showroom (4.6%) and still leads on dealer and service reach.

Choose the CFMoto 250 Dual-EFI if
  • the ex-showroom price is your binding constraint
  • you want servicing within reach of where you live

Measured: 16 more service centres in Nepal (18 vs 2).
